Good morning, everybody. Welcome to our Second Quarter 2019 Earnings Conference Call. I will start the presentation where we show the main highlights of our performance for the quarter. Recurring net income was BRL7 billion which represented a 2.3% growth when compared with the previous quarter, and resulted in a 23.5% ROE.
